MPH differnce in 93 octane vs E60 file in the 1/2 mile?

Any educated guesses at the what MPH difference an FBO with inlet 335i (stock turbo) could expect between the two files?

I like the ease at which I could arrive at the track running 93 octane - no drama. Also, if I run 93, I can let it get down to an 1/8th tank to save on weight. With the E60 file, I'll need to run close to a full tank off gas, since I'll have a few gallons of 93 in the tanks when I mix in the ethanol.

I'm sure then extra timing from ethanol would easily offset the extra 66 lbs of ethanol, but just wanted to get feedback.

My best guess is around 3 MPH based on the weight savings versus power loss. I ran 140 or 141 last year in Clayton on E60 and a 4K DA, so I'm hoping to see the same speed on 93 next week in Indiana with the better DA.
